An open water tight railway wagon of mass 5 × 103 kg coasts at an initial velocity 1.2 m/s without friction on a railway track. Rain drops fall vertically downwards into the wagon. The velocity of the wagon after it has collected 103 kg of water will be
Options
A.0.5 m/s
B.2 m/s
C.1 m/s
D.1.5 m/s
Solution
Sol. (Fext)H = 0 ∴ rain falls vertical
∴ 5 × 103 × 1.2 = 6 × 103 × v
⇒ v = 1.0 m/s
